      Description

      This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from April 12, 2024
      Bring your own builder! Welcome to Lot 3 at Brookwood Estates!

      A wonderful opportunity to build your dream home on 3.5+ acres in Cabarrus County with no HOA. Lot 3 of Brookwood Estates (plat attached) is 3.52 acres +/- and has approximately 175' of road frontage; 100' of cleared land and 450' of wood land that slopes down to a small creek. Plenty of room for a walk-out basement or a ranch home with a back yard and then private undisturbed land filled with hardwoods. Bring your own builder or ask for recommendations! See additional possibilities to buy 2 acres - Lot 4 - on same recorded plat under separate listings on MLS, 4103355.

      You can find the recorded plat with Cabarrus County Register of Deeds at Plat Book 98 at page 53.

      Home percs for a conventional system - 5 bedroom home.

      Shared entry off Alexander Road for first 25 feet, then separate drieway is allowed, per NCDOT and recorded plat.
